#e80095 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e80095 is composed of 91% red, 0%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 100% magenta, 35.8% yellow and 9% black. It has a hue angle of 321.5 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 45.5%. #e80095 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ff00ff with #d1002b. Closest websafe color is: #ff0099.

#e80095 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e80095 has RGB values of R:232, G:0, B:149 and CMYK values of C:0, M:1, Y:0.36, K:0.09. Its decimal value is 15204501.

Shades and Tints of #e80095

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#10000a is the darkest color, while #fffcf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#e80095

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7d6b77 is the less saturated color, while #e80095 is the most saturated one.
